6. Global eCommerce Needs Hreflang Implementation
For Magento stores operating across multiple regions or languages, hreflang tags are essential for proper localization and avoiding duplicate content issues. 8. Take Full Control Over Meta Tags and Robots Directives
Meta tags and robots directives remain foundational for technical SEO. In 2025, merchants must have full control over these elements across all URLs.
